Our team is looking for a driven, strategic, customer-centric business leader with experience running an event merchandise operations team. This role will help innovate all systems and processes for selling merch virtually, and for pop-up events, via Amazon supply chain systems. This role will be responsible for overseeing all aspects of the livestream & live event revenue stream, including building an event operations team, forecast and inventory management, facilitating production & shipping logistics, overseeing execution, and interfacing with external teams. The successful candidate will have deep experience in event merchandise operations and must be a creative problem solver with the ability to maximize onsite, and online, sale strategies. The candidate should also feel comfortable dealing with ambiguity and working in an entrepreneurial environment.
The Sr Manager of Live Event Merch Operations will report within the Amazon Music Merch team and will work closely with apparel production, shipping logistics, finance, vendor managers, marketing, and external teams to shape the livestreaming and live event strategy for Amazon Music. The candidate must have the leadership presence and communication skills to represent Amazon at all levels of our partners' organizations.
Key job responsibilities
• Act as the 'business owner' for assigned artist/vendor partners, possessing a complete understanding (inclusive of the strategic context) of internal and external variables that impact your business (this entails owning forecasting, monitoring, understanding and reporting on the business, along with responsibility for driving operations and solutions to achieve live music merchandise business objectives
• Assist with the development of product lines with production, vendor managers, merch companies, and artist teams
• Oversee merchandise logistics, from production to point of sale
• Forecasting and inventory management of events and business lines
• Facilitate negotiations with external parties to meet profitability goals
• Vet on-site capabilities and onboard new systems and processes for operators
• Hire, manage, and monitor independent contractors
• Monitor shipping and logistics, and optimize instock and capacity to meet customer demand and financial goals
